Transaction 93cf0259bf42afe0475d363d2cc8a3227f4211c2bd5e0d4c666435e88e7600c8
1 Input
1 Output
-
93cf0259bf42afe0475d363d2cc8a3227f4211c2bd5e0d4c666435e88e7600c8:0
- value
- 23800142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17e1528f77b8552315bd5d9b0a9b60cd2d50b246 OP_EQUAL
- address
- MA5RhXMYQkN3viZZgHiW8Yq1GzZvXVjiDW